Я пытался заставить мой контейнер Grafana работать с моим обратным прокси, но безуспешно. Все, что я пробую, приводит к тому, что страница «Если вы видите, что Grafana не смогла загрузить файлы приложения», появляется независимо от того, открываю ли я ее, используя внутренний IP-адрес или внешний URL-адрес для него.
My DockerСоставьте в конферансье на данный момент, обратите внимание, что ни одна из этих переменных окружения сейчас не используется, поэтому #
version: '2'
services:
grafana:
image: grafana/grafana
hostname: grafana
container_name: grafana
network_mode: le_bridge
ports:
- 3000:3000
#environment:
#GF_SERVER_DOMAIN: 'myurl.ddns.net'
#GF_SERVER_ROOT_URL: 'https://myurl.ddns.net:443/grafana'
restart: unless-stopped
volumes:
- /Docker_Configs/grafana/config:/etc/grafana
- /Docker_Configs/grafana/data:/var/lib/grafana
Мой grafana.ini
[server]
domain = myurl.ddns.net
root_url = https://myurl.ddns.net/grafana/
Мой конфиг обратного прокси-сервера
location /grafana/{
include /config/nginx/proxy.conf;
proxy_pass http://192.168.2.13:3000/;